I'm trying to import a basic A-posed clothing piece made with Marvelous Designer to my A-posed Michael 7 (Genesis 3) character.
Here's what happens when I use Transfer Utility to fit the polo to the character :

Before Rigging :

 

After rigging using Transfer Utility feature :

 

Poke-throughs are not a problem, I can deal with that. The real issue is the sleeves, look at how deformed they are.

I bend the character's arms by 60 degrees to fit the cloth shape before rigging and I get this weird issue.
I tried rigging with the character and cloth both T-posed, it works.
But the problem is, I have to work with clothes that are A-posed when using Marvelous Designer to get realistic results.

What can I do to correct it please ?

    I have found the solution. I just had to rotate the cloth's joint to 60 degrees just like my character's. :)

  • Transfer Utility works on the zeroed shape - the trick witht hings like this is to use the bake Rotations command (Joint Editor option menu) on the posed figure so that the A pose looks like the zeroed pose, use Transfer Utility, bend the arms on the newly rigged shirt back up, and Bake Rotations on that.
